OverviewAre you a proven leader with a strong drive to succeed?Do you work well in a process-driven environment where organization and efficiency are critical to success?Are you an expert multitasker who would thrive in a high-energy environment?If so, then this might be the right opportunity for you!As an Operations Service Manager at Burlington, one of the largest off-price retailers in the country, you’ll be one of leaders of the store team, participating in managing the overall operations of the store.You will serve as a role model for store associates, demonstrating and reinforcing the company’s Core Values, developing trust and respect among peers and staff, building strong teams and partnerships, and driving business results. You’ll coach, train and develop a team of Cashiers and Customer Service Supervisors while also overseeing business operations to ensure our associates are delivering excellence customer service and the highest degree of professionalism.Responsibilities:

Manages the Customer Service and Cashier teams, driving compliance to company policies and standards, safekeeping of company funds and property, asset protection, sales, and record keeping procedures.

Provides guidance to the Customer Service Supervisors to ensure they are meeting customer service expectations and there is smooth customer flow at the registers.

Manages the overall execution of operations and receiving SOPS, including the continuous flow process.

Monitors the receiving process, transfers, debits, damages, and charge-backs and partners with the Receiving Supervisor to maintain the accuracy of inventory.

Supports the Store Manager and others in areas including but not limited to staffing, sourcing, interviewing, training, and succession planning.

Assist in the management of other store operations areas as needed.

Candidates must have 3+ years of Retail Management or Store Operations experience at an Off Price, Big Box, Specialty or medium to large-sized, multi-unit retail organization and be able to work a flexible schedule; including early mornings, nights, weekends, holidaysand required travel, as needed. Candidates must also be able to lift and move boxes weighing up to 40 lbs. and should be comfortable utilizing scheduling and reporting computer software.If you……want to work at a fast-growing company with a proven track record of promoting from within…are excited to deliver great merchandise values to customers every day;…take pride and ownership in helping drive positive results for a team;…are committed to treating colleagues and customers with respect;…are an ambassador in cultivating an inclusive workplace that values diversity;…want to participate in initiatives that positively impact the world around you;Come join our team. You’re going to like it here!You will enjoy a competitive wage, flexible hours, and an associate discount. Burlington’s benefits package includes medical, dental and vision coverage including life and disability insurance. Full time associates may also be eligible for up to 12 days of paid time off annually, up to 8 paid holidays, paid sick time in accordance with applicable law, and a 401(k) plan.
